等待中的准备工作

前端之家收集整理的这篇文章主要介绍了等待中的准备工作前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。

方案提交了,所长还在看,没叫我呢。

这两天,没什么事了。。但也不敢闲着啊。玩意所长突然叫我,说开始吧,不久麻爪了吗。。

根据方案,调查一下看看怎么做吧。

首先还是静态测试。找几个工具,试试效果吧。

pclint,试了两天,还行,可以用,环境也搭建起来了,检查了两个文件,行。

C++check,简单易用,但是规则明显没有pclint细,但也有pclint见不到它能检到的。。各有利弊。可能倒是后两个都用吧。

针对C的静态检测工具还没怎么找,用C++check测了一下C程序,只测到一个小问题,估计不够,稍候再查查。

针对VB的还没有找,针对C#的,vs2008 team suit就有,以前试过,不用找了。


最令我头疼的,是怎么往我们那个C++程序总加入白盒测试。

程序只有一个exe工程,无lib,无dll。

开始想在工程中添加测试代码,测试代码与工程代码不混在一起,并且用预编译命令控制。试了一下,发现没法打桩函数,也没法mock。放弃。

不做白盒测试吧,光靠系统测试测不完整,而领导的意思是要完整的测试,以保证以后尽量不出或少出bug,看来白盒不可少。


想了几天想不出好办法,最后决定每个测试用例分离出一份代码副本,在副本中,加入测试代码修改代码作为桩和mock,进行测试。这样做无疑是个很笨的方法,但还有更好的办法吗。这样做还有个前提,测试用例中详细记录修改方法,以便下次测试的时候,能够准确还原测试环境,也为了测试完成后,能够准确还原工程代码。没有实际操作,不知道可行不可行,但工作量肯定小不了。。


C语言的测试呢?VB的测试呢。。VB尤其恶心,代码量大,界面代码多,事件多,我还没有考虑怎么整。天啊。C#倒是好点,可以用vs2008自带测试工具添加测试工程进行测试。


人员也是问题,现有人员本来就不够用,不可能从其他项目招人进来,只能从社会招人,需要会写代码,水平还不能太低,因为要参与代码质量控制,自己水平不够,怎么监督别人。 还要有测试经验,至少写过单元测试吧。


试着搭建版本服务器和bug管理服务器。。版本管理用svn,已经在本机搭建了一个服务器,bug管理用bugfree,还没有整好。


现在就我一个光杆司令,慢慢来吧。。

猜你在找的VB相关文章